Phillips 66 (NYSE:PSX) EVP Vanessa Allen Sutherland Sells 4,394 Shares

Phillips 66 (NYSE:PSXGet Free Report) EVP Vanessa Allen Sutherland sold 4,394 shares of the stock in a transaction dated Friday, January 9th. The stock was sold at an average price of $145.00, for a total transaction of $637,130.00. Following the sale, the executive vice president owned 30,193 shares in the company, valued at approximately $4,377,985. This trade represents a 12.70% decrease in their position. Phillips 66 Company Profile

Phillips 66 (NYSE: PSX) is an independent energy manufacturing and logistics company engaged primarily in refining, midstream transportation, marketing and chemicals. The company processes crude oil into transportation fuels, lubricants and other petroleum products, operates pipeline and storage infrastructure, and participates in petrochemical production through strategic investments. Phillips 66 serves commercial, industrial and retail customers and positions its operations across the value chain of the downstream energy sector.

The company’s principal activities include refining crude oil into gasoline, diesel, jet fuel and feedstocks for petrochemical production; operating midstream assets such as pipelines, terminals and fractionators that move and store crude oil and natural gas liquids; and marketing and distributing fuels and lubricants through wholesale and retail channels.
